Your search should start with brokers who have proven experience in Pennsylvania. State-specific programs can be a game-changer. Ask any broker you interview about the PHFA (Pennsylvania Housing Finance Agency) programs. These include down payment and closing cost assistance, as well as first-time homebuyer loans with competitive rates. A broker well-versed in PHFA's Keystone Government, Conventional, and Renovation loans can potentially unlock thousands of dollars in assistance or better terms, which is incredibly valuable in our market.
Here is your actionable plan. First, go beyond online reviews. Ask for referrals from your real estate agent, friends, or family who have recently purchased locally. A broker's reputation in our close-knit communities is telling. When you speak with candidates, ask them pointed questions: "Can you share an example of a challenging South Fork or Cambria County property you helped finance?" and "How do you typically structure loans for buyers with variable income, like those in seasonal or contract work common in our region?" Their answers will reveal their depth of local experience.
Finally, choose a communicator. The mortgage process can feel overwhelming. The best mortgage broker for you will explain the steps, the jargon, and the timeline in a way you understand, responding promptly to your concerns. They should proactively discuss how Pennsylvania's property taxes and homeowners insurance trends might affect your overall payment.
